原文:jquery的ajax同步和異步

之前一直在寫JQUERY代碼的時候遇到AJAX加載數據都需要考慮代碼運行順序問題。最近的項目用了到AJAX同步。這個同步的意思是當JS代碼加載到當前AJAX的時候會把頁面里所有的代碼停止加載,頁面出去假死狀態,當這個AJAX執行完畢后才會繼續運行其他代碼頁面假死狀態解除。而異步則這個AJAX代碼運行中的時候其他代碼一樣可以運行。jquery的async:false,這個屬性默認是true:異步,f ...

2015-03-18 11:06 0 45220 推薦指數:

查看詳情

jQuery Ajax異步同步

在實際使用中,我們經常會用的Ajax異步加載,在不刷新整個網頁的前提下對網頁部分內容進行更新) 使用時,偶爾會遇上需要從一個接口中得到一個數組和數據對應的id,在另一個接口上再得到數據,最初寫法如下: 但是此時經常會出現數組清空后並沒有寫入數據的問題,初學時常誤以為時接口錯誤 ...

Sat Oct 13 19:42:00 CST 2018 0 2243
JQueryAjax 異步同步淺談

Ajax 同步異步的區別 同步是當 JS 代碼加載到當前 Ajax 的時候會把頁面里所有的代碼停止加載,頁面出現假死狀態;當這個 Ajax 執行完畢后才會繼續運行其他代碼此時頁面假死狀態才會解除。反之異步Ajax 代碼在運行時,其余的 JS 腳本依舊能夠運行。 在 Jquery ...

Sat Nov 14 02:24:00 CST 2015 0 2546
Jquery $.ajax,$.post,同步異步問題

今天發現$.get的回調函數無法賦值 debug發現在,回調函數還未執行時賦值操作已完成考慮到可能是異步操作。在網上查找資料發現:Jquery封裝好的$.post $.get發得請求都為“異步”請求,所以發出請求后還沒等一般處理程序處理返回結果,就執行了為變量賦值,因此取到的值總 ...

Mon Feb 25 01:32:00 CST 2019 0 4074
jquery ajax屬性async(同步異步)

jqueryajax中如果我們希望實現同步或者異步時我們可以直接設置async屬性為false和true 同步執行 當把async設為false時,這時ajax的請求時同步的 也就是說,這個時候ajax塊發出請求后,他會等待在load()這個地方,不會去執行after() 直到load ...

Sun Nov 25 23:45:00 CST 2018 0 9157
jquery ajax屬性async(同步異步)示例

jqueryajax中如果我們希望實現同步或者異步我們可以直接設置async發生為真或假即可true false,下面舉幾個jquery ajax同步異步實例 例1、jquery+ajax/" target="_blank">jquery ajax同步方式 ...

Mon Aug 14 22:08:00 CST 2017 1 70856
ajax同步異步的區別

ajax異步請求:異步請求就當發出請求的同時,瀏覽器可以繼續做任何事,Ajax發送請求並不會影響頁面的加載與用戶的操作,相當於是在兩條線上,各走各的,互不影響。一般默認值為true。異步請求可以完全不影響用戶的體驗效果,無論請求的時間長或者短,用戶都在專心的操作頁面的其他內容,並不會有等待的感覺 ...

Thu Dec 24 02:27:00 CST 2020 0 962
ajax同步異步區別

ajax同步異步區別 我們在使用ajax一般都會使用異步處理。 異步處理呢就是我們通過事件觸發到ajax,請求服務器,在這個期間無論服務器有沒有響應,客戶端的其他代碼一樣可以運行。 同步處理:我們通過實踐觸發ajax,請求服務器,在這個期間等待服務器處理請求,在這個期間客戶端不能做任何處理 ...

Tue Sep 24 02:58:00 CST 2019 0 1058
Ajax同步異步

參考http://blog.csdn.net/cursor2000/article/details/5677479代碼下載 ...

Sat Jan 18 21:28:00 CST 2014 0 6963
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M